Well I finally got her running properly! I used a Hyundai Elantra head (1.6L) and put it on there. The head was $39.99 and it was $100 to pressure test my old head to see if it was screwed. I opted to just buy the new head and try it out instead of paying $100 to find out my head is bad anyways. Turned out to be a good idea! No more coolant and white smoke out the exhuast, I guess my other head was cracked after all. WAHHHOOOOO! Im so happy now. I dont even notice a difference in power with the 1.6L head and smaller cumbustion chambers. If anything I notice more throttle responce with the higher compression I have now. (8.2:1)
